Output 57a51dbddf4e52158ab9b7dc21e66133020ed1496e3c5d49053d132d1efedca8:1

value
1851685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8083436d39a40d9a660a38b056731c2d4c652741 OP_EQUAL
address
3DQXfSMXvocLhxUcXVTA3LkZoNEPvADjCm
transaction
57a51dbddf4e52158ab9b7dc21e66133020ed1496e3c5d49053d132d1efedca8
spent
true